Teaching possiblities and teacher planning: a look at teaching practices, procedures and strategies from teaching plans

This article's investigative proposal is the need to reflect on pedagogical elements adopted in the classroom and with this aim it aims to investigate the practices, procedures and strategies adopted by Geography teachers in Elementary School Final Years based on the analysis of Geography teaching plans School. To this end, a bibliographic survey on the approach to Geography from BNCC/Brazil and the practices, procedures and strategies of the selected teachers became essential. In the methodology, an exploratory research was used with a qualitative approach that focused on collecting data from the teaching plans used by Final Year Elementary School teachers, considering five different teachers from different institutions in the municipalities of Paraíba. The research results were considered with the support of the official document proposed by the National Common Curricular Base (BNCC) and it was found that teachers demonstrate using the Base's guidelines in their pedagogical practices. However, some weaknesses were also observed based on the practices exposed in the teaching plans. Given this, the present study presents itself as a possibility for teachers, students or society as interested people to consider the possibility of understanding some of the practices, procedures and pedagogical strategies used in teaching Geography within the school context.
